As a initially step, Nazi governors in the annexed territories (such as Arthur Greiser in the Warthegau and Albert Forster in Danzig-West Prussia) forcibly deported hundreds of thousands of Poles into the Generalgouvernement. Far more than 500,000 ethnic Germans have been then settled in these regions. In 1942–43, SS and Police units carried out Germanization actions in the Zamosc area of the Generalgouvernement, forcibly removing some one hundred,000 Polish civilians, including 30,000 young children.
